Feeding Behavior

Beetles exhibit a wide range of feeding behaviors, depending on their species and habitat. Some beetles are herbivores, feeding on plant material such as leaves, fruits, and nectar. Others are carnivores, preying on other insects or small invertebrates. There are also beetles that are scavengers, feeding on decaying organic matter.

Here is a table summarizing the feeding behavior of different beetle species:

Beetle Species Feeding Behavior
Rhynchophorus ferrugineus Herbivore
Carabus auratus Carnivore
Nicrophorus vespilloides Scavenger

Reproductive Behavior

Reproductive behavior in beetles is diverse and often involves intricate mating rituals. Male beetles may use pheromones to attract females, engage in elaborate courtship displays, or even engage in physical combat with rival males to secure mating opportunities.

Here are some common reproductive behaviors observed in beetles:

  • Mating dances
  • Release of pheromones
  • Territorial displays
  • Parental care

Defense Mechanisms

Beetles have evolved various defense mechanisms to protect themselves from predators. Some beetles have hard exoskeletons that provide physical protection, while others may secrete toxic chemicals or use camouflage to avoid detection.

Here are some common defense mechanisms seen in beetles:

  1. Camouflage
  2. Chemical defense
  3. Mimicry
  4. Playing dead
